In a saucepan mix the cocoa powder, salt, sugar and espresso powder together. Stir in the tablespoon of milk and mix until it is a thick syrup. Add in the vanilla extract and chocolate chips.
Over medium heat, melt the chocolate chips in your mix. Stir often so it doesn't burn or scorch.Once smooth, add in the cup of milk and stir well.Heat while stirring occasionally until it is heated through and the chocolate mix is combined well into the milk. I keep it on medium heat so it doesn't scorch and the milk doesn't boil over.
Marshmallow Froth
Add the milk and marshmallows into a microwave safe cup. I do this while the hot chocolate is heating up on the stove so they are ready together.Microwave for 25-35 seconds, depending on your microwave. For a 1000 watt, microwave it for 30 seconds.
If you have a frother, use it to froth up the marshmallow and milk. If you do not have one, stir fast with a fork (almost like you are whipping it) to get it frothy.
Putting it Together
Once the mix is heated on the stove, pour into your favorite mug.Once you have made your marshmallow froth, pour it on top of the hot chocolate.Enjoy!
Notes
For salt: A pinch in this recipe is putting some salt in the palm of your hand. Take your thumb and pointer finger and grab as much of a pinch of salt as you can (in one shot.) This can be easily doubled or even quadrupled in the same pot and divided equally among cups. Espresso powder is optional but we do recommend it if you have it or can get it. It enhances the flavor, but can be left out.The chocolate chips are best if it is a heaping tablespoon. A few extra will not hurt!
